The Paramount+ series Dutton Ranch wrapped its first season with a fatal shooting that leaves the killer's identity unresolved. Actor Juan Pablo Raba, who plays Joaquin, discussed the twist in an interview. The episode also introduced new developments involving pregnancy and hostages.
In the season finale, Oreana discovers her father Rob-Will bleeding from a gunshot at the Jacksons' home. Viewers see Joaquin in a car with a gun earlier, yet no scene confirms he fired the shot.
Raba told TVLine that the script showed doubt and heartbreak rather than resolve. He suggested Mariano might have arranged a backup plan and noted the killer appeared experienced.
Other plot points include Oreana learning she is pregnant and Mariano taking Carter hostage at the end. The episode also covered cartel ties at the 10-Petal Ranch and conflicts involving Beth, Rip, and Everett.
Raba said the open ending allows for storylines in season two.
